WebPerform antigen retrieval on formaldehyde-fixed tissue sections to expose antigenic sites and allow antibodies to bind. Formaldehyde fixation results in protein cross-linking (methylene bridges), which masks epitopes and can restrict antigen-antibody binding. Web24 Oct 2024 · Use a dropper to apply the primary stain (crystal violet) to the slide and allow it to sit for 1 minute. Gently rinse the slide with water no longer than 5 seconds to remove excess stain. Rinsing too long can remove too much color, while not rinsing long enough may allow too much stain to remain on gram-negative cells.
